This engraving titled "A Portion of Winchester House, which Survived until the Nineteenth Century" takes us back in time to witness a fragment of history that has long since vanished. Created by an anonymous English School artist in the 19th century, this print showcases a section of Winchester House that managed to withstand the test of time until the 1800s. The intricate details and meticulous craftsmanship captured in this image transport us into a world where grandeur and opulence reigned supreme. The surviving portion of Winchester House stands as a testament to its former glory, evoking curiosity about what once stood beyond its walls. Originally featured as an illustration for Sir Walter Besant's book "London South of the Thames" published by A & C Black in 1912, this digitally cleaned image allows us to appreciate every fine line and delicate shading with clarity.
